homebuyercounseling Homebuyer Counseling Impacts Homeownership Literacy Potential homeowners who participate in pre-purchase education and counseling programs may be more likely to pay their mortgages on time, according to a study released by the Mortgage Bankers Association (MBA).

Pre-purchase homeownership education and counseling programs proliferated before the current housing downturn, and may be expanded if public interest dictates.
